Guy who played Barney for 10 years reveals life inside the purple suit
Barney & Friends is certainly one of the most scorned of kids’ TV shows, yet the purple dinosaur was beloved to small children all over the world. The guy who inhabited Barney from 10 years is still a fan as well. David Joyner, who played the friendly dinosaur from 1991 to 2001, revealed to Business Insider what life was like inside that purple suit. He gets a bit more mystical than you might expect:
There’s a lot of psychic energy in my family, and there’s a lot of clairvoyance. And a lot of times, with me, if I’m trying to figure out a situation, I’ll dream about it.
Well the night before the audition, I had this dream. And in this dream, Barney passes out. And I have to give Barney mouth-to-mouth resuscitation… And then it hits me. I had to breathe life into Barney in my dream. If I go into this audition and breathe life into this character… So, of course, they called me and asked if I would be Barney. And I said, “Of course.” I pretty much already knew that I was going to be Barney. But it was great getting that phone call.
Joyner does admit that lumbering around in a 70-pound suit was pretty cumbersome, as well as extremely sweaty.
